#76372f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76372f is composed of 46.3% red, 21.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 6.8 degrees, a saturation of 43% and a lightness of 32.4%. #76372f color hex could be obtained by blending #ec6e5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#76372f color description : Dark moderate red.
#76372f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#76372f has RGB values of R:118, G:55,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.6,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7747375.
